Patent number: 10296865Abstract: A system and method for shipping an item is presented that reduces the number of steps involved in the physical process and protects shipper and recipient privacy. The shipper is not required to label a package with the shipper's name or address, the recipient's name or address, or proof of payment. Instead the shipper scans a barcode on the package that encodes a package identifier, and causes a recipient identifier and payment information to be associated with the package identifier in a database. The recipient then causes his or her address to be associated with the recipient identifier.Type: GrantFiled: January 28, 2016Date of Patent: May 21, 2019Inventor: Peter Oliver Schmidt

Patent number: 8999652Abstract: Mixtures of cell types can be analyzed by having at least two signal markers, with at least one at three different levels to provide a barcode for each cell type. The mixture of cells may be subjected to a common candidate moiety and the effect of the moiety on the cells determined along with identification of the cell by the barcode. Conveniently, surface marker proteins and labeled antibodies can be used to create the barcode and the cells analyzed with flow cytometry.Type: GrantFiled: August 5, 2008Date of Patent: April 7, 2015Assignee: Primity Bio, Inc.Inventors: Peter Oliver Krutzik, Thomas Scott Wehrman

Publication number: 20030225876Abstract: A network management software system monitors and displays performance and capacity information about networks and computers using computer graphics similar to weather maps one might see on television. High-resolution color graphics allow the display of thousands of pieces of performance on network information on one computer screen. This allows end users to view computer performance metrics such as processor utilization, disc capacity and application availability, in large network computing environments across thousand of network elements at a glance. Virtually any metric that can be determined from a network element may be displayed. Thus, performance information is collected and displayed to the end user in a color-coded graphical format that also depicts the network as opposed to the traditional tabular format. This eliminates the need for the end-user to “work” the application in an attempt to monitor performance.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 31, 2002Publication date: December 4, 2003Inventors: Peter Oliver, David Hudock

Patent number: 5786416Abstract: A high specific gravity composition suitable for use as a lead-substitute, especially for firearms ammunition and angling weights, comprises:(i) a polymer matrix comprising:(a) at least one rigid thermoplastic polymer component, e.g. polypropylene, polystyrene, etc. and(b) at least one elastomeric thermoplastic polymer component, e.g. various polystyrene-based copolymers; and(ii) dispersed in the polymer matrix particles of a high specific gravity weight material having a density and present in an amount such that the composition has a specific gravity of greater than one, preferably a specific gravity in the range 8 to 12.The high specific gravity weight material is preferably tungsten powder.Type: GrantFiled: October 24, 1997Date of Patent: July 28, 1998Assignees: John C. Gardner, Peter J. GardnerInventors: John Christopher Gardner, Peter James Gardner, Ian Peter Oliver, Terry Peake
